Overview
Improvix Technologies is looking for a dynamic and innovative Business Analyst to support our government customer. This role works hand-in-hand with senior project managers, product owners, and key government stakeholders to understand functional and business process needs, capture requirements, and translate solutions into succinct user stories for technical resources. The BA also serves as Scrum Master for their team, helping teammates resolve impediments and risks, while staying on target within every sprint.
The Business Analyst will play a critical role in managing customer onboarding, intake and discovery, requirements gathering, customer communication, and documentation. This individual will work closely with developers, engineers, project managers, and federal stakeholders to ensure customer satisfaction and service excellence.

Day-to-day responsibilities
- Regularly meeting with senior-level government officials that serve as Product Owners and/or key stakeholders to ongoing projectized efforts.
- Proactively seeking customer feedback, identifying opportunities for improvement, and helping translate the customers' functional business processes and needs to technical resources.
- Collaborating with SMEs to write and edit Knowledge Base Articles (KBAs), User Guides, Procedures, SOPs, and related project materials.
- Capturing user stories, grooming, and recording stories within Jira.
- Assisting with demos, as necessary, to ensure customer satisfaction at the end of each sprint.
- Working with developers, engineers, and testers to ensure broad understanding of technical details and requirements within each user story.
- Evaluating project activities, processes, and procedures; proposing innovative approaches for improvement.
- Assisting the Project Manager with updating status reports, risk registries, Release Notes, and related project documentation.
- Researching, outlining, writing, and editing new and existing product content (e.g., OnDemand Training Guides, System Documentation, Tier I/II Troubleshooting Guides).
